import { AppError, CanvasError, ImageError, StorageError, TextError } from "$lib/error.types"; import { createError, formatError, logError } from "$lib/utils/errorUtils"; import { describe, expect, it, vi } from "vitest"; describe("errorUtils", () => { describe("formatError", () => { it("should format AppError", () => { const error = new AppError("Test error", "TEST_CODE"); const result = formatError(error, "Default message"); expect(result).toBe("Default message: Test error"); }); it("should format Error", () => { const error = new Error("Test error"); const result = formatError(error, "Default message"); expect(result).toBe("Default message: Test error"); }); it("should format string error", () => { const error = "String error message"; const result = formatError(error, "Default message"); expect(result).toBe("Default message: String error message"); }); it("should format unknown error", () => { const error = { custom: "object" }; const result = formatError(error, "Default message"); expect(result).toBe("Default message: Произошла неизвестная ошибка"); }); it("should use default message when not provided", () => { const error = new Error("Test error"); const result = formatError(error); expect(result).toBe("Произошла ошибка: Test error"); }); it("should format ImageError", () => { const error = new ImageError("Image failed"); const result = formatError(error, "Default message"); expect(result).toBe("Default message: Image failed"); }); it("should format TextError", () => { const error = new TextError("Text failed"); const result = formatError(error, "Default message"); expect(result).toBe("Default message: Text failed"); }); it("should format CanvasError", () => { const error = new CanvasError("Canvas failed"); const result = formatError(error, "Default message"); expect(result).toBe("Default message: Canvas failed"); }); it("should format StorageError", () => { const error = new StorageError("Storage failed"); const result = formatError(error, "Default message"); expect(result).toBe("Default message: Storage failed"); }); }); describe("createError", () => { it("should create AppError with message and code", () => { const error = createError("Test error", "TEST_CODE"); expect(error).toBeInstanceOf(AppError); expect(error.message).toBe("Test error"); expect(error.code).toBe("TEST_CODE"); expect(error.details).toBeUndefined(); }); it("should create AppError with message, code and details", () => { const details = { userId: 123, action: "test" }; const error = createError("Test error", "TEST_CODE", details); expect(error.details).toEqual(details); expect(error.message).toBe("Test error"); expect(error.code).toBe("TEST_CODE"); }); }); describe("logError", () => { it("should log Error with stack", () => { const consoleSpy = vi.spyOn(console, "error").mockImplementation(() => {}); const error = new Error("Test error"); logError(error, "Test context"); expect(consoleSpy).toHaveBeenCalledWith("Error occurred:", { error, context: "Test context", timestamp: expect.any(String), stack: expect.any(String), }); consoleSpy.mockRestore(); }); it("should log AppError with stack", () => { const consoleSpy = vi.spyOn(console, "error").mockImplementation(() => {}); const error = new AppError("Test error", "TEST_CODE"); logError(error, "Test context"); expect(consoleSpy).toHaveBeenCalledWith("Error occurred:", { error, context: "Test context", timestamp: expect.any(String), stack: expect.any(String), }); consoleSpy.mockRestore(); }); it("should log string error without stack", () => { const consoleSpy = vi.spyOn(console, "error").mockImplementation(() => {}); logError("String error", "Test context"); expect(consoleSpy).toHaveBeenCalledWith("Error occurred:", { error: "String error", context: "Test context", timestamp: expect.any(String), stack: undefined, }); consoleSpy.mockRestore(); }); it("should log error without context", () => { const consoleSpy = vi.spyOn(console, "error").mockImplementation(() => {}); const error = new Error("Test error"); logError(error); expect(consoleSpy).toHaveBeenCalledWith("Error occurred:", { error, context: undefined, timestamp: expect.any(String), stack: expect.any(String), }); consoleSpy.mockRestore(); }); }); });
